Public Audit and Post-legislative Scrutiny Committee

Thursday 17 May 2018 9:00 AM

LIVE

Details

1. Decision on taking business in private: The Committee will decide whether to take items 3 and 4 in private. 2. Early learning and childcare: The Committee will take evidence from- Paul Johnston, Director General, Education, Communities and Justice, Joe Griffin, Director for Early Learning and Childcare, and Alison Cumming, Programme Lead, Early Learning and Childcare, Scottish Government; Vicki Bibby, Chief Officer for Finance, and Jane O'Donnell, Chief Officer for Children and Young People, COSLA. 3. Early learning and childcare: The Committee will consider the evidence heard at agenda item 2 and take further evidence from— Caroline Gardner, Auditor General for Scotland; Antony Clark, Assistant Director of Performance Audit and Best Value, and Rebecca Smallwood, Senior Auditor, Audit Scotland. 4. Work programme: The Committee will consider its approach to the 2016/17 audit of the Scottish Government's Non-Domestic Rating Account, the Scotland Act 2016: audit and accountability arrangements and the CAP Futures programme.
